Company Overview:

Washi Microfinance Uganda Limited is a newly established microfinance institution backed by Japanese investment and expertise, beginning operations in Mbale, Uganda. Our mission is to provide accessible, responsible, and customer-focused financial services that empower individuals, entrepreneurs, and small businesses to grow sustainably.

Grounded in strong ethical values and international best practices, Washi Microfinance delivers tailored lending, savings, and financial inclusion solutions while maintaining high standards of governance, risk management, and community support. We value integrity, professionalism, and positive impact, and are committed to fostering economic opportunity and long-term partnerships across the communities we serve.

Role Description:

The Field Officer is responsible for mobilizing clients, conducting loan appraisals, supporting loan disbursement, monitoring repayments, and maintaining a high-quality loan portfolio. The role involves extensive fieldwork, strong community engagement, and direct client support, while ensuring compliance with credit policies, regulatory standards, and institutional procedures to promote responsible lending and portfolio growth.

Key Responsibilities:

Client Mobilization & Business Development

  • Identify, sensitize, and recruit potential clients within assigned areas.
  • Facilitate group formation and training for group lending methodologies.
  • Promote loan, savings, and other financial products.
  • Build strong relationships with community leaders and local networks.

Loan Appraisal & Processing

  • Conduct detailed loan assessments including business visits, household checks, and cash-flow analysis.
  • Verify client information, guarantors, collateral, and business viability.
  • Prepare accurate appraisal reports and ensure clients understand loan terms and obligations.

Loan Disbursement & Portfolio Management

  • Support timely and compliant loan disbursement.
  • Monitor repayments through field visits, center meetings, and follow-ups.
  • Maintain portfolio quality by ensuring on-time repayments and actively recovering overdue loans.
  • Take proactive action to reduce Portfolio at Risk (PAR).

Customer Service & Client Support

  • Provide basic financial literacy and business advisory support to clients.
  • Handle client inquiries and complaints professionally.
  • Maintain a positive institutional image in the community.

Reporting & Compliance

  • Prepare daily, weekly, and monthly field and portfolio reports.
  • Maintain accurate client documentation and system entries.
  • Adhere strictly to credit policies and regulatory guidelines.
  • Immediately report suspected fraud, misrepresentation, or operational risks.

Qualifications and Experience:

  • Diploma or Bachelor’s in Microfinance, Business, Finance, Accounting, or related field.
  • 2–5 years microfinance experience preferred.
  • Fieldwork experience required (motorcycle riding skill is an advantage).

Core Competencies:

  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ills
  • High integrity and accountability
  • Ability to work independently in the field
  • Customer-focused mindset
  • Basic analytical skills

Key Performance Indicators:

  • Portfolio growth and quality
  • Repayment and recovery rates
  • Client retention
  • Accuracy of documentation and reporting
